V bearings are a type of linear bearing consisting of a V-shaped groove with a ball or roller running along it. This design allows for precise linear movement with minimal friction and wear, making them ideal for applications requiring high accuracy and durability.Advantages of V Bearings
V bearings offer a plethora of advantages that have made them indispensable in various industries: *Low Friction: The V-shaped groove design minimizes contact between the ball or roller and the bearing surface, reducing friction and energy consumption. *
High Precision: V bearings provide excellent straightness and parallelism, ensuring precise linear movement. *
Durability: Constructed from high-quality materials and heat-treated for enhanced strength, V bearings can withstand heavy loads and extended operating life. *
Self-Alignment: The V-shaped groove allows for minor misalignments, ensuring smooth operation even in challenging conditions. *
Low Noise: Due to their low friction, V bearings operate quietly, minimizing noise and vibration.
Applications of V Bearings
V bearings find widespread application in industries ranging from manufacturing to medical technology: *Machine Tools: Linear motion in CNC machines, lathes, and milling machines *
Robotics: Joints and axes in industrial robots *
Medical Equipment: Actuators and positioning systems in MRI machines and surgical robots *
Packaging Machinery: Conveying and positioning systems in packaging lines *
Linear Actuators: For precise linear motion in automation and motion control applications

V bearings typically comprise the following components: *V-Shaped Groove: Precision-ground for smooth and accurate linear movement *
Ball or Roller: High-carbon chromium steel for strength and wear resistance *
Cage: Maintains proper spacing and prevents ball or roller contact *
Lubricant: Specialized grease for long-term lubrication *
Materials: Stainless steel, hardened steel, or ceramic for corrosion resistance and extended life
Proper Installation and Maintenance
Correct installation and maintenance are essential for maximizing the performance and lifespan of V bearings: *Proper Alignment: Ensure proper alignment of the bearing with the shaft or guide rail to prevent premature wear. *
Adequate Lubrication: Follow the manufacturers recommendations for lubrication intervals and use the specified lubricant. *
Regular Inspection: Periodic visual inspection helps detect any signs of wear or damage, allowing for timely repairs.
